/// Make a filter for graphql queries/mutations.
///
/// The `schema` argument is your juniper schema.
///
/// The `context_extractor` argument should be a filter that provides the GraphQL context required by the schema.
///
/// In order to avoid blocking, this helper will use the `tokio_threadpool` threadpool created by hyper to resolve GraphQL requests.
///
/// Example:
///
/// ```
/// # extern crate juniper_warp;
/// # extern crate juniper;
/// # extern crate warp;
/// #
/// # use std::sync::Arc;
/// # use warp::Filter;
/// # use juniper::{EmptyMutation, EmptySubscription, RootNode};
/// # use juniper_warp::make_graphql_filter;
/// #
/// type UserId = String;
/// # #[derive(Debug)]
/// struct AppState(Vec<i64>);
/// struct ExampleContext(Arc<AppState>, UserId);
///
/// struct QueryRoot;
///
/// #[juniper::graphql_object(
///    Context = ExampleContext
/// )]
/// impl QueryRoot {
///     fn say_hello(context: &ExampleContext) -> String {
///         format!(
///             "good morning {}, the app state is {:?}",
///             context.1,
///             context.0
///         )
///     }
/// }
///
/// let schema = RootNode::new(QueryRoot, EmptyMutation::new(), EmptySubscription::new());
///
/// let app_state = Arc::new(AppState(vec![3, 4, 5]));
/// let app_state = warp::any().map(move || app_state.clone());
///
/// let context_extractor = warp::any()
///     .and(warp::header::<String>("authorization"))
///     .and(app_state)
///     .map(|auth_header: String, app_state: Arc<AppState>| {
///         let user_id = auth_header; // we believe them
///         ExampleContext(app_state, user_id)
///     })
///     .boxed();
///
/// let graphql_filter = make_graphql_filter(schema, context_extractor);
///
/// let graphql_endpoint = warp::path("graphql")
///     .and(warp::post())
///     .and(graphql_filter);
/// ```

/// Create a filter that replies with an HTML page containing GraphiQL. This does not handle routing, so you can mount it on any endpoint.
///
/// For example:
///
/// ```
/// # extern crate warp;
/// # extern crate juniper_warp;
/// #
/// # use warp::Filter;
/// # use juniper_warp::graphiql_filter;
/// #
/// let graphiql_route = warp::path("graphiql").and(graphiql_filter("/graphql",
/// None));
/// ```
///
/// Or with subscriptions support, provide the subscriptions endpoint URL:
///
/// ```
/// # extern crate warp;
/// # extern crate juniper_warp;
/// #
/// # use warp::Filter;
/// # use juniper_warp::graphiql_filter;
/// #
/// let graphiql_route = warp::path("graphiql").and(graphiql_filter("/graphql",
/// Some("ws://localhost:8080/subscriptions")));
/// ```
